What are the most common Honda repair issues seen in Coal Hill due to local driving conditions?

Given the mix of rural roads and highway driving around Coal Hill, we frequently see suspension wear, alignment issues from potholes, and premature brake wear. Honda models like the CR-V and Accord also commonly need attention for CVT transmission maintenance and air conditioning service, especially after enduring Arkansas's hot, humid summers.

When should I seek local service for my Honda's check engine light instead of trying to diagnose it myself?

You should seek professional diagnosis immediately if the light is flashing, indicating a severe misfire, or if you notice any performance loss, strange noises, or overheating. Local shops have the advanced scan tools necessary to accurately read Honda-specific codes, which is crucial for models with VTEC engines or complex emissions systems.

What local factors should Coal Hill Honda owners consider for preventative maintenance?

Due to high humidity and seasonal temperature swings, pay extra attention to your battery, air conditioning system, and windshield wipers. Furthermore, frequent travel on gravel or uneven rural roads around Johnson County makes regular tire rotations, suspension checks, and undercarriage inspections for corrosion especially important for longevity.
